ISA-Certified Tree Services

Northeast Florida trees grow in tough conditions — extreme summer humidity, sandy coastal soils that drain fast, hurricane and tropical-storm wind damage, and pine bark beetle pressure on slash and loblolly pines. Our tree services in Fruit Cove include expert tree trimming done at the right time of year — which, for live oaks and sabal palms here, matters more than most homeowners realize. We focus on removing weak and crossing limbs, opening up airflow, and protecting your trees from the issues that actually show up in this region.

On a typical Fruit Cove lot, the trees you see most are red maple, crape myrtle, yaupon holly and more. Our certified arborists handle the full scope — pruning, fertilization, structural work, and pest pressure — including:

  • Tree trimming, timed to dormancy and pre-hurricane window
  • Tree removal
  • Deep-root fertilization tuned for sandy coastal soil
  • Insect and disease management
  • Cabling & bracing for older live oaks and storm-loaded limbs
  • Storm damage cleanup after Northeast Florida tropical-storm events

It’s the difference between Fruit Cove trees that quietly decline and trees that thrive on the same lot for decades.

Fruit Cove Lawn Care Programs (Coming Soon)

Your Fruit Cove lawn lives or dies by what gets done in the first 60 days of the growing season. St. Augustine, Bahiagrass, Zoysia, and Centipede each behave differently in our sandy soil and Florida humidity, and what works in May can fall apart by August if the program isn’t dialed in. Our lawn care programs stay on that calendar:

  • Soil testing and custom fertilization tuned to fast-draining sandy soil
  • Aeration and overseeding timed to our long growing season
  • Pre- and post-emergent weed control timed for Northeast Florida (the first round goes down in early February)
  • Chinch bug and grub management — the two pests that wreck a lawn here

When the calendar is right, your Fruit Cove lawn takes care of itself the rest of the year.
